Beginner-Friendly: The language was designed with the beginner in mind, so that he or she can focus on programming and not memory management. Advanced memory management tools in Java, including the Garbage Collector, take care of this for you. Its syntax is English-like, with a minimum of magic characters. Adaptability: Because Java is universally available, it can run on all kinds of computers, including Macs, Windows, and Linux. It’s used for large-scale software and applications that are widely distributed. This makes it a great choice for many industries and platforms. With these benefits, Java is also often referred to as the “write-once-run-anywhere” programming language. The best part? Almost anything can run Java code!
